Nakamba has played around 70 games for us and we’ve lost quite a few of them. He was good those four games before the injury, but why was that?

Some like the Birmingham Mail claim he was ”transformed” by Gerrard. How? Magical powers? I saw a Nakamba in great physical shape, playing the same way he always does: patrolling an area outside the box and making tackles.

It worked well because Villa in those games were set up to primarily defend. We played some difficult sides and more or less handed over possession (low 30s), defending in a tight and narrow block while the opposition passed the ball around us, sideways and out on the flanks.

Do we want to go back to playing like that? Against difficult teams we probably should and Nakamba has traditionally done well against the best teams where Villa spend much of games under attack. But do we want to hand over possession and spend most of the game defending in a tight block against teams like Watford, Burnley or even Southampton?

Gerrard says he wants us to become a more possession oriented side. We haven’t seen much of that yet. With Nakamba such a change could be even more difficult, even though he’s a great ball winner, since he’s not very comfortable is possession and definitely not when pressed (few of our players are actually).

I also look forward to Nakamba returning  but feel some have unrealistic expectations based on those four games. He will likely be the same Nakamba with strengths and weaknesses, not a player forever transformed after a few training sessions with Gerrard in November.

It’s a funny one because we have Luiz who is more comfortable in possession but limited defensively and Marv who is physical and tackles well but is so basic on the ball. My view of what happened with Marv when Gerrard came in was his role was just simplified for him, try and break up play and give the ball out wide, and it worked fine. Douglas is better at taking the ball from the defence but I don’t think he’s anything special at it. Against Newcastle our only luck in the first half came when Mings and chambers pushed through the middle. So I actually think the role of Douglas and us keeping possession is overestimated. He has good moments from playing deep but he’s too much of a passenger in that position for me. His best game for us this season was against city and Marv played in the middle in that game. I don’t think Marvs a long term solution at all, but I think we’ll benefit from having him in the middle and worrying about who plays either side of him.
